There’s a brand new Burlesque show in the North Texas region called Texas Star Burlesque, and they’re having their first epic show smack dab in the middle of Dallas, TX on Saturday July 14th at 9PM. The venue will be the historic and landmark locale ‘Trees‘ in Deep Ellum and will feature a ton of amazing and famous performers from around nation. Official Release: Texas Star Burlesque is proud to present their inaugural showcase, The Belles of Burlesque! Get your fill of classic burlesque, high flying circus stunts, mystical magic, and so much more! Just like the old days, the price of an admission ticket gets you an awe-inspiring show within an immersive burlesque experience. See Ginger Valentine from LA, award winning striptease artist seen among the ranks of Dita Von Teese’s “Art of the Teese”, instructor, and Burlesque Hall of Famer, known for her knockout stage presence and athletic, sensual performances.

Enjoy the delights of Bunny Galore, the queen of the 7 fires and Miss Viva Las Vegas 2016, all the way from Denver. They’ll be joined by award winning aerialist ickymuffin, sensual teasers Red Snapper and Lascivious Lark (Amarillo), local powerhouse Donna Denise, San Antonio’s multi talented, Black Orchid, and hosted by emcee, Tifa Tittlywinks (Houston). Plus pre-show entertainment by Emma d’Lemma, magician Urial Gwydian, AND MORE!
